Upgraded Hydraulic Fork
Adjustable 80mm-travel hydraulic front fork soaks up potholes, kerbs and rough surfaces for a smoother, more controlled ride.
Rear Air Shock
A 50mm-travel air shock with damping completes the full-suspension setup, keeping the ride planted and comfortable over bumps.
20" x 4.5" INNOVA Fat Tyres
Wide puncture-resistant fat tyres on 36H alloy rims grip loose, wet and uneven ground while cushioning every ride.
4-Piston Hydraulic Brakes
Powerful hydraulic disc brakes with 180mm rotors and motor cut-off deliver sure, progressive stopping in all conditions.
Shimano 7-Speed
A reliable Shimano 7-speed drivetrain (14–28T freewheel, 44T chainring) gives you the right gear for hills, headwinds and flat-out cruising.
Memory-Foam Saddle
A motorcycle-style memory-foam saddle with pressure-relief shaping keeps you comfortable mile after mile.

Is the Eahora Romeo II road-legal in Ireland?
The Romeo II is speed-limited to 25 km/h, matching the EU pedelec (EPAC) speed cap. Because it uses two 250W motors for a 500W combined output, its total power is above the 250W figure in the strict single-motor pedelec definition. For fully rule-compliant road use, select a single-motor mode (front-only or rear-only, 250W) and ride in pedal-assist — dual-motor and throttle use are best kept for private land and trails. What is the real-world range?
Eahora rates the Romeo II at 173–193 km on pedal assist and 125–144 km on throttle from its 52V 60Ah (3120Wh) battery. Real range depends on rider weight, terrain, assist level, tyre pressure and temperature — expect the higher figures on flatter routes in lower assist, and less in hilly or cold conditions or on throttle only.
